Block 12612558

0x21885a52ec34e54126129e269b753e2c40d81d1625e619161809efcb68011f55
Transactions0
Height12612558
Confirmations8798527
TimestampSat, 24 Apr 2021 12:39:35 UTC
Size (bytes)529
Version
Merkle Root
Nonce0x5f5aec610c7895fe
Bits
Difficulty0xa204fe389a31